Penn State Hazleton chemical engineering major Trevor Ruggiero was selected for a 2023-34 Multi-Campus Research Experience for Undergraduates, providing him a third consecutive semester of experience in a research laboratory.

Three faculty members at Penn State Hazleton received promotions in their academic ranks, effective July 1. Lori Reno was promoted to associate teaching professor of business, Shannon Richie was promoted to librarian and Megan Schall was promoted to associate professor of biology.
An international team of researchers have confirmed that microplastics impact how sand travels along riverbeds, which could increase riverbed erosion and have effects on river habitats.
